
Iliamna Lake dominates this mid-century landscape, serving as the central hub for the region's isolated settlements and seasonal camps. The map documents the shifting population patterns of the era, noting Old Iliamna while highlighting active centers like Nondalton, Newhalen, and Fish Village. Transportation is defined by water and the occasional Tractor Trail, connecting sites such as Roadhouse and Hedlunds to the shore.
